How Iowa law applies in Guthrie Center

Iowa has no separate rate rule for Guthrie Center; the sourced rows below are what reach every lender that serves its 1,579 people.

RuleDetailSource
State lending regulatorIowa Division of Banking (IDOB), Iowa Department of Insurance and Financial Services
Source says: "As part of the 2023 state government realignment, the IDOB became part of a new Department of Insurance and Financial Services".
Iowa Division of Banking
as of 2026-09-16
Payday lending statusPermitted under license (delayed deposit services; must be physically located in Iowa)
Source says: "A person shall not operate a delayed deposit services business in this state unless the person is physically located in this state and licensed by the superintendent".
Iowa Legislature (Iowa Code)
as of 2026-09-16
Small-loan / installment lender licensingRegulated Loan Act license required (superintendent of banking)
Source says: "shall not engage in the business of making loans ... without first obtaining a license from the superintendent of banking".
Iowa Legislature (Iowa Code)

Before you apply in Guthrie Center

Before you hand your details to a lender in Guthrie Center, where the population is near 1,579:

  1. Pull your credit reports first and correct any error before a lender sees the file.
  2. Test your amount and term in the personal loan calculator first.
  3. Get several pre-qualifications and compare APR side by side before choosing.
  4. Check the Iowa regulator's records to confirm the lender is licensed here.
  5. Be clear on what the loan is for and how it gets repaid.
  6. If the balances are already a strain, seek nonprofit credit counselling before adding a loan.
  7. Read the disclosure for an origination fee and any prepayment penalty before signing.

Common questions

What are my options in Guthrie Center if my credit is poor?
Borrowing is still possible, but expect a higher APR and a smaller approved amount. Lenders that accept lower scores hold statewide licences, so what is open to you in Guthrie Center is the same as anywhere in Iowa.
What loan size can I expect in Guthrie Center?
Most personal loans sit somewhere between $1,000 and $50,000, though the figure you are approved for turns on the lender, your income and your credit. Model the monthly payment first with our personal loan calculator.
Do I have to pledge anything to borrow in Guthrie Center?
For an unsecured personal loan, no — there is nothing to pledge. A secured loan, such as home equity or one secured by a vehicle, does require collateral, and default puts that asset at risk.
Does comparing loans in Guthrie Center cost me credit score points?
Not during pre-qualification, which normally uses a soft pull and leaves your score alone. Submitting a full application triggers a hard inquiry, which can trim a few points briefly.
